You don't need to believe me. How about this?
But Jean-Claude Piris, formerly the director-general of the EU Council’s legal service, said the idea – refusing to appoint a new commissioner – would fail to shut down the EU, as No 10 hoped.
“The Commission can continue to work and decide legally,” Mr Piris wrote on Twitter, citing a precedent dating back to 1999.
Instead, he said: “The UK will be brought to the EUCJ [the European Court of Justice] for violation of its obligation.”
